US Holds 74% of AI Compute, EU 4.8%, Bloomberg Analysis Shows

  • Policy & Regulation
  • Infra & Chips

On June 26, 2026, Bloomberg Opinion published an editorial arguing that the European Union's structural lack of integration could prove fatal in the race for AI dominance. While the US controls roughly 74% of the world's high-performance AI compute, the EU's share stands at just 4.8%, underscoring a widening gap in both investment and infrastructure.
